Transaction 63eaa7a129b4754fa5f12cd4cb9a4d6b21065a64ac20d8d69de1975790797efc

1 Input
2 Outputs
  • 63eaa7a129b4754fa5f12cd4cb9a4d6b21065a64ac20d8d69de1975790797efc:0
  • value  1775475
    address  2NFZohhxA5HU98HQu7TdDTwB2GaFXahvVGT
  • 63eaa7a129b4754fa5f12cd4cb9a4d6b21065a64ac20d8d69de1975790797efc:1
  • value  4060404438
    address  2MtP1FDikDJf865waFdY7eJNNiSZU6g8Yt8